Title: Helmut Braun: Innovator in Data Transmission Technology
Introduction
Helmut Braun is a notable inventor based in Kirchheim-Teck,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of data transmission technology. His innovative approach has led to the development of a unique payout device that enhances the efficiency of data transmission lines.
Latest Patents
Helmut Braun holds a patent for a "Payout device for data transmission lines and method for the production of payout device." This invention involves a storage device designed for data transmission lines that facilitate communication between a moving object and a base station. The device features a spool unit on which the data transmission line is wound in multiple layers. Each layer is wound under maximum tensile stress, which is calculated based on the properties of the data transmission line and the spool unit. This design minimizes material creep and ensures stable winding over time, with pressure on the underlying layers kept below 0.6 N/mm.
